I have been playing and editing a boat risk world/europe map extensively the past month or so (8 player). I'm planning to host a tournament for it in the coming weeks, starting signs ups here and advertisements on aoe3 TAD servers via open room.
The map I have been editing has no choke points, no pathing issues, no trees for example to prevent units getting stuck and so on and after playing it around 30 times now with 8 players I'm confident it is truly stable and balanced enough to offer it up for a tournament.
I kinda want to make a prize money pool and maybe ESOC community might help guide me in the right direction or help? As they have done so in the past with the standard 1v1 tournaments.
If you know anyone that can help with the prize pool fundraiser/offer any help in making this tournament an official thing on this forum I would much appreciate it.
I can make an official post soon and provide the map we will play on.

If you make a full description, perhaps you can post it on the User Created Content board, so that people can find it there. Then link/copy the post here.
If there are enough people who like the idea, we can definitely offer support. In general, we really like members taking initiative and we have supported non-official-tournaments in the past. You should now focus on collecting feedback on the map and getting people excited to play it.
I personally don't know this scenario yet, but I have a lot of experience playing scenario's, and I would love to see a tournament focused on scenario's. Basically, it's using the AoE3 engine to play games other than AoE3. High-level colosseum (the scenario where you choose units to spawn and fight for the center of the map) or high-level cannibal (the scenario where 7 players have to build walls and towers to protect themselves from a very powerful enemy) sound like they could be very exciting to watch.
